There is now another 4G LTE operator here in Nigeria which is ready  to compete with the already existing 4G providers which are MTN-VisaFone, Ntel, Smile 4G, Spectranet, Swift. This new company was launched on the 23rd of August, this year 2016.

InterC is here to offer us fast internet speed at a very affordable price. According to InterC, they will be offering free internet for the first month, and 25% off on the second month.

InterC List Of Data Plans

InterC Lite:
1.5GB Plan for N1,400 (24/7 30 Days Validity)
4GB for N2,800 (24/7 30 Days)
2.5GB for N1,500 (6PM – 6AM 7Days validity)
1GB for N1,000 (6PM – 6AM 7Days validity)

InterC Savvy
7GB for N4,500 (24/7 30 Days Validity)
15GB for N7,000 (24/7 30 Days Validity)
25GB for N10,000 (24/7 30 Days Validity)
40GB for N9,000 (6PM – 6AM 30 Days Validity)
25GB for N6,000 (6PM – 6AM 30 Days validity)

InterC Ultra
50GB for N17,000 (24/7 30 Days Validity)
75GB for N24,000 (24/7 30 Days Validity)
110GB for N35,000 (24/7 60 Days Validity)
75GB for N12,000 (6PM – 6AM 30 Days Validity).

STATES IN NIGERIA INTERC WILL BEGIN OPERATION

They will start operation in Abuja, Port Harcourt, and Kaduna at first, before rolling out to Lagos and other locations.
